Shakespeare Lions are collecting used spectacles and hearing aids and sending them to deserving people in the third world. 1500 Lions Clubs across the UK collected over one million pairs of used spectacles last year. The spectacles and hearing aids are tested, serviced and sent with a qualified team of opticians via the Lions Eye Health Programme. Lions are particularly interested in early detection and timely treatment of diabetic eye disease, glaucoma and macular degeneration, and are famous for their eye care programmes in the U.K. and across the World.
